Output 5251800a83582a3f632f864c68ab46149b087c9366973fe496b15afe75483ac3:6

value
28559771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d59bdaa833ebf440302d81f52d571a14d8b80b OP_EQUAL
address
MEp8ocmMFr4yqHwM4QRWEaL58kMEGSsqJM
transaction
5251800a83582a3f632f864c68ab46149b087c9366973fe496b15afe75483ac3
spent
true